Output 694d890a52c317f7d4e941dedea27f428f5f9a6ceed07d20bd3843c6f487cf17:3

value
21256104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ee0c0711cd249e48422bcfbbcdacb188c25c855 OP_EQUAL
address
MLvdRhCBKbTCSxWH3Aanmguahe6yySVxWm
transaction
694d890a52c317f7d4e941dedea27f428f5f9a6ceed07d20bd3843c6f487cf17
spent
true